Elemento del report personalizzato (CRI) di SQL 2005 Reporting Services: quali sono i limiti?

StackOverflow https://stackoverflow.com/questions/20821

Domanda

Lettura MSDN (e altre fonti) sugli elementi del report personalizzato (CRI) per i servizi di reporting 2005.Sembra che mi sia limitato a generare una bitmap.Nemmeno con qualche sovrapposizione di mappatura per rilevare i clic del mouse su di esso.C'è un modo per aggirare questo problema?Ci sono due cose che vorrei fare:

  • Incorpora HTML direttamente nel report per formattare il testo dinamico.
  • Incorpora il controllo Flash (swf) nel report.Questo potrebbe essere fatto con HTML se il punto precedente è possibile.Ma forse c'è un altro modo

Eventuali suggerimenti?Cosa mi manca?

È stato utile?

Soluzione

Non ti sei perso nulla.

Per me, come hai detto tu, lo svantaggio principale è che con un CRI puoi solo eseguire il rendering delle immagini.Non ottieni alcun testo scalabile o qualcosa di simile.Se vuoi includere swf, devi renderlo come immagine statica.

Altri suggerimenti

È possibile eseguire il rendering del report come HTML e includerlo utilizzando un frame mobile in una pagina con il file swf.È possibile utilizzare le funzioni per formattare il testo dinamico.SSRS 2008 risolve alcuni di questi problemi con la casella di testo con formattazione "ricca" (non RTF).potrebbe valere la pena dargli un'occhiata, se è un'opzione.

Potresti voler dare un'occhiata Report sulla dinamica dei dati che dispone di tutte le funzionalità RS e offre un supporto migliore per gli elementi dei report personalizzati con un'API completa e non solo bitmap.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top